Crowds of youths have been making their way into North Belfast this evening (Saturday), according to police.
And they have issued warnings to parents, pointing out that they are risking their children’s safety.
Police say they are out patrolling the various parks – Bone Hills, Woodvale Park, Girdwood Hub and the streets surrounding these parks.
“Police have their roof mounted camera land rovers out tonight and will be in these parks.
“For the parents who are dropping their kids off to these parks, please have a good look at what you are doing. You are risking yours kids’ safety and showing your lack of responsibility to your kids, yourself and to this community,” said a police spokesperson.
Police say this only refers to a minority of parents and that they would like to put on record their thanks to the responsible parents and the community workers within the area.
